Print, From a Series of Naval Battles for Wedding Festivities of Cosimo Il de'Medici, Jason's Ship
This is a Print. It was etched by Remigio Cantagallina and after Giulio Parigi and patron: Cosimo II de' Medici. It is dated 1608 and we acquired it in 1941. Its medium is etching on paper. It is a part of the Drawings, Prints, and Graphic Design department.

Its dimensions are
26.8 x 40.7 cm (10 9/16 in. x 16 in.) Platemark: 19.5 x 27 cm (7 11/16 x 10 5/8 in.)
It is inscribed
Black ink, lower margin: Reale dell' Armata degl. Argorauti dove era Giasone rappresentato dal Ser. Sposo; lower left margin: Remigio Canta Gallina F.; lower right margin: Batalgia Navale Rappa in Armo per le nozze dell' Ser.mo Principe de Tosacana l'anno 1608. Giulio Parigi I.
